Whole Home Water Filtration in Cincinnati, OH
Whole Home Water Filtration services provide a comprehensive solution for improving the quality of water throughout a property. This service involves installing a filtration system at the main water supply line, ensuring that every faucet, shower, and appliance receives clean, filtered water. Projects typically include assessing the existing plumbing, selecting the appropriate filtration technology, and installing the system to address common concerns such as sediment, chlorine, odors, or contaminants. Homeowners often request this service when they notice issues like foul tastes, unpleasant odors, or mineral buildup in their water, or when they want to ensure their household water is safe and free from impurities.
Before requesting Whole Home Water Filtration, property owners usually want to understand the types of contaminants that may be present in their water supply and the specific filtration options available. It’s also helpful to know the size and capacity of the system needed for the household’s water usage, as well as any maintenance requirements. Clarifying these details can ensure the selected system effectively addresses their water quality concerns and provides consistent, high-quality water throughout the property.

Common Whole Home Water Filtration Jobs
Whole Home Water Filtration - systems improve water quality throughout the entire property.
Point-of-Entry Filtration - filters water at the main supply line to remove contaminants before distribution.
Sediment Removal - systems eliminate dirt, rust, and debris for clearer, cleaner water.
Chemical Reduction - filtration options reduce chlorine, chloramine, and other chemicals affecting taste and odor.
Hard Water Treatment - solutions help reduce mineral buildup and improve water softness.
Maintenance and Replacement - regular servicing ensures continued effectiveness of the filtration system.
Whole Home Water Filtration Questions
What is whole home water filtration? It is a system that filters all the water entering a property, providing cleaner water for drinking, bathing, and appliances.
How does a whole home water filter improve water quality? It removes contaminants such as chlorine, sediment, and other impurities, resulting in better-tasting and safer water throughout the property.
Is installation of a whole home water filtration system disruptive? Installation typically involves connecting the system to the main water line and may require some plumbing work, but it is generally straightforward and minimally disruptive.
What types of contaminants can a whole home water filter remove? It can reduce chlorine, sediment, heavy metals, and certain chemicals, depending on the filter type used.
